A social determinant of health is a factor or condition that influences and shapes an individual’s health outcomes. It refers to the social, economic, and environmental conditions that affect an individual’s overall well-being. These determinants act as significant forces that determine access to healthcare, health behaviors, and health outcomes. They include factors such as education, income, employment status, social support, and access to healthcare services.

Public opinion regarding social determinants of health can have a considerable impact on healthcare policy. When the public recognizes and understands the influence of social determinants on health outcomes, they are more likely to advocate for policies and programs that address these issues. Public opinion can shape healthcare policies by influencing policymakers, policymakers’ decision-making, and resource allocation. For example, if the public perceives access to education as an essential social determinant of health, they may support policies that improve educational opportunities and resources for all individuals, which can have long-term positive impacts on health outcomes.

As a leader in addressing social determinants of health within an organization, various strategic implementation efforts can be employed to address these issues effectively. Firstly, conducting comprehensive needs assessments to identify the specific social determinants that are most prevalent in the target population is crucial. This can be done through surveys, focus groups, and data analysis.

Secondly, forming partnerships and collaborations with community organizations, government agencies, and non-profit organizations can facilitate the development and implementation of interventions targeting social determinants of health. These partnerships can help leverage resources, expertise, and community engagement to address the underlying causes of health disparities.

Additionally, it is essential to advocate for policies and programs that support the social determinants of health through active involvement in policymaking processes. This can include providing expert input, participating in task forces and committees, and engaging with community members to ensure policies align with the needs of the population.

Moreover, educating healthcare professionals and students about the impact of social determinants of health is crucial. Integrating this topic into the medical curriculum and providing training opportunities and resources can enhance their understanding and ability to address social determinants of health in their practice.
